Location and Administration

Samdo (183/2) comes under Samdo (183/2) gram panchayat and Spiti C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Spiti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The tehsil headquarters is Kaza at 74 km. The Census district headquarters, Kyelang, is 261 km away.

Population Profile

The population details below are from Census 2011 village records. They help you understand the size of Samdo (183/2) village and its household count.

Total population

598 residents in 19 households

Male population

532

Female population

66

SC/ST population

Scheduled Castes: 51; Scheduled Tribes: 36

Agriculture and Land Use

Land-use area is reported in hectares using Census village directory land-use categories such as net area sown, irrigated area, forest, fallow land and non-agricultural use. This is useful for general village research, farming context and local area study.

Agriculture and land-use records for Samdo (183/2)
Non-agricultural area54.37 hectares
Main cropGreen Peas
Second cropBarley
Third cropWheat
